📝 Our Take

Small House - Right Set is a charming glimpse into LEGO's early history. This set, released in 1958 as part of the Town Plan series, showcases the simple yet effective design principles that would come to define the LEGO brand. With its classic red and white color scheme and basic geometric shapes, it's a nostalgic reminder of LEGO's roots.

This set is perfect for vintage LEGO collectors and history buffs. Its small size makes it an easy display piece, and its historical significance adds a unique dimension to any collection. The limited number of pieces also makes it a quick and enjoyable build.

📦 Full Parts Inventory - 8 unique parts • 21 total pieces

The set features a collection of basic bricks in white, blue and red, providing essential building blocks for simple constructions. The inclusion of round bricks and corner pieces adds a touch of architectural detail, despite the limited piece count.
